The P6KE24HE3/54 is a transient voltage suppressor diode designed to protect electronic circuits from voltage spikes and transients. The P6KE24HE3/54 TVS diode has a simple two-pin configuration with anode and cathode connections.
The P6KE24HE3/54 operates by diverting excess transient energy away from sensitive components, thereby limiting the voltage across the protected circuit.
The P6KE24HE3/54 is commonly used in various applications, including: - Power supplies - Communication equipment - Automotive electronics - Industrial control systems - Consumer electronics
